Output 5aba71911ce8a2495395b1bc8c4985c1fad455ac3e9536e2d6143e108363f6eb:3

value
170573
script pubkey
OP_0 OP_PUSHBYTES_20 3ef7b6258935205cc4636b3fb9b723186304086a
address
bc1q8mmmvfvfx5s9e3rrdvlmnderrp3sgzr23k0pjg
transaction
5aba71911ce8a2495395b1bc8c4985c1fad455ac3e9536e2d6143e108363f6eb
confirmations
106767
spent
true